A traffic collision was reported on northbound State Route 41 at the Shields Avenue off-ramp in Yolo County shortly after 7:21 a.m. on Aug. 24, according to California Highway Patrol dispatch records. The dispatch log listed the injury status as unknown, meaning whether anyone was hurt had not been confirmed at the time of the report.
No further details were included in the dispatch entry. The number of vehicles involved and what led to the crash were not specified in the record.

California accident information
- Injury statute of limitations
- 2 years (From date of injury (CCP 335.1).)
- Wrongful death statute of limitations
- 2 years (From date of death (CCP 377.60).)
- Fault rule
- California uses pure comparative negligence: partial fault reduces recovery proportionally but does not bar it.
- Citations
- CCP 335.1 (SoL); CCP 377.60 (wrongful death); pure comparative per Li v. Yellow Cab
- Crash report agency
- California Highway Patrol (CHP 190 request) for CHP-investigated crashes; local police/sheriff otherwise.
